    Stuckey Signs Multi-Year Deal

    Chargers re-signed FS Darrell Stuckey to a multi-year contract.
    Stuckey was the Chargers' highest remaining priority after extending Donald Butler and will return as a special teams captain and reserve safety. He appeared in all 16 games last season, finishing with 21 tackles. Stuckey is unlikely to push for significant defensive snaps in 2014.
